k3b ummm...just doesn't burn
 
I installed k3b and wanted to burn some mp3s to a cd. I put them in a new project and hit Burn. It ripped all the tracks to .wav format but it just doesn't burn them. Nothing happens it just stays at 50% complete. Just to test what was going on I used the 'Erase CD-R' option to see if k3b was even recognizing my cd burner. It spun and everything went as planned.

This doesn't work with data either. I don't know if I have to mess around with any options or what. ho-hum

<EDIT>
Don't mind me I'm an idiot. I'm ashamed to say what the problem is but just in case anybody else has a problem like this make sure the cd in the drive wasn't already written to.
</EDIT>
